LANXESS: Release of Durethan®, a recycled glass fiber-reinforced polyamide for the automotive industry

The automotive industry is the third largest consumer industry of polymer materials after packaging and construction. By using engineering plastics with recyclable components, automobile companies around the world are increasingly relying on limited resources for production.

To meet this demand, LANXESS, the world’s leading global supplier of specialty chemicals and polymer materials based in Cologne, Germany, has worked closely with leaders in the automotive industry to develop a series of recycled glass fiber reinforcements suitable Polyamide for the manufacture of auto parts. 

The development of new technologies for more efficient manufacturing As people are increasingly concerned about climate change, environmental degradation and rising raw material prices, sustainability has become a strategic focus of automotive companies. Through engineering and innovation, companies in the industry continue to develop new technologies to solve these problems.

Additive manufacturing technology can achieve higher material efficiency parts design, and use highly reusable advanced 3D printing materials to reduce the environmental impact of the final product.

However, in mass production, additive manufacturing is much less than injection molding (currently the most commonly used manufacturing process for automotive plastic parts). The initial investment of a large amount of energy and resources related to the mold design and manufacturing process, as well as plastic waste in the form of gates and burrs (the technical cavity of the excess filling material and the openings in the mold), which must be removed from the finished parts and recycle and re-use. This constitutes a major obstacle to sustainable injection molding manufacturing.

Injection molded plastic components that reduce environmental impact

As one of the major suppliers of composite materials for the global automotive industry, LANXESS is in a very advantageous position to provide solutions that can reduce high environmental costs and carbon footprint.

Leveraging on the long-standing technical expertise of LANXESS’ high-performance materials business unit, the company has expanded its Durethan® polyamide-based reinforced composite material range to include reinforced recycled glass fiber products.

Polyamide is one of the most versatile engineering thermoplastics, widely used in the automotive industry, consumer goods manufacturing, and a range of electrical and electronic applications. Polyamide material has excellent high temperature and resistance properties, and its partially crystalline structure makes it chemically resistant.

The glass fiber reinforced polyamide of the Durethan® series has extremely strong resilience, so it can be used as a substitute for traditional metal alloys. These characteristics make reinforced polyamides useful for components that may withstand significant impacts and must ensure safe impact energy dissipation, such as radiators, headlight covers, and other structural components of automotive front-end components.
